Demystifying AI with TechRadar & Tom’s Guide: Do consumers really care?
“AI” is the marketing buzzword of the day — from laptops to washing machines, consumers come across the term everywhere. But do they actually understand what it means — and do they even want all these AI products?
Led by the experts at TechRadar and Tom’s Guide, this session will dive into original research from Future around how everyday consumers perceive AI, the benefits they seek, and the barriers they face, uncovering key and strategic opportunities for tech brands on how best to engage and educate consumers.
